Teaching

The Department of Biochemistry and Human Biology (DBBH) is actively involved in teaching several FFUL courses and also some courses in association with ULisboa Schools or other higher education institutions.

Specialties in Cellular and Molecular Biology, Biochemistry, Pharmaceutical Biotechnology and Toxicology.
